Is JOSE R JUAREZ safe to load? JOSE R JUAREZ (USDOT 1890897, MC-680820) is an active owner-operator motor carrier based in CASTROVILLE, CA, operating 3 power units and 11 drivers. Operating authority has been active 17 years (past the 24-month broker-confidence threshold). Across 19 roadside inspections, its vehicle out-of-service rate over the last 24 months is 66.7% (above the 22.26% national average), with 1 reportable crash in the last 24 months. FMCSA has not assigned a safety rating. Vektor rates it high risk (42/100), with the leading concern: no active operating authority. Source: FMCSA SAFER/MCMIS, last updated 2026-06-13.
